... Read moreWhile giving signs to your best friend can often be playful and fun, it's crucial to understand the nuances of non-verbal communication. Body language plays a significant role in how we convey messages, even without words. Familiarize yourself with common signs such as nods, winks, and hand gestures that can express a range of emotions, from excitement to caution. Knowing when and how to deploy these signs can enhance mutual understanding. In social settings, context matters. Consider the environment and the mood when attempting to communicate silently with your bsf. Whether you’re at a party or in a quiet café, your demeanor and energy can change the effectiveness of your signs. It's also essential to be sensitive to how your friend interprets these signals - what might seem like a flirty gesture to you could be perceived differently by them. Strengthening your friendship goes beyond these signals; engaging in open dialogues about feelings and boundaries can further deepen your bond. So whether you're planning a surprise or trying to convey your emotions subtly, mastering the art of signaling can certainly add a fun and meaningful layer to your relationship.
